More white #orcas found in NW Pacific! When we did our paper on #white or #albino whales in 2016 (DOI: 10.1578/AM.42.3.2016.350) we found incidence of white individuals was 1 in 1,000. One other pod had 2 white ones plus 3 or more in various other pods 1/2

France just passed a climate action law based on proposals from an assembly of randomly picked citizens
> Cracks down on car, home and plane emissions
> Stronger sanctions for soil, air and water pollution
> Bans fossil fuel advertising
